The gray primer is Mr. Surfacer 1500. I was careful about spraying light coats of Tamiya white primer over the gray this time. I gave it two light coats over everything according to previous posts on page 3 ( my memory is not helping much.) Contrary to what I had said, I did not wet sand the white but waited almost a week before the orange, mostly due to weather. I let it rest a couple of days before the rub-out. No issues this time. Just a little touch-up to do now. I put the interior together. After the lid goes on you can't see much of it. It's not fancy but the dash is interesting to some degree, IMHO. Hanging pedals with aluminum diamond-plate treads - very home-built 😉. Gotta find the shifter....it's here somewhere......sure am glad the dash isn't glued....
